Wallace Shawn is one of the most complex and uncompromising moralists of the American theater. - Ben Brantley, New York TimesAt once the U.S.'s most profound and overlooked playwright. - David HareThis translation and adaptation of Henrik Ibsen's Master Builder Solness by Wallace Shawn, a writer known for his own bleakly hilarious and provocative plays, was used by legendary director Andr Gregory during fifteen years of work on a theatrical production which, instead of being produced as a play, was made into a film by Jonathan Demmea film that is an utterly contemporary vision of Ibsen's classic play.
